Office Specialist - Transportation
Non-contract, No Benefits
Starting date: 6/15/2026
Hourly rate: $22.00
- Answers questions from internal and external parties (e.g. staff, parents, students, public agencies, etc.) for the purpose of providing general information and referral.
- Attends department and/or in-service meetings (e.g. presenting/sharing information as requested, etc.) for the purpose of conveying and/or gathering information required to implement assigned functions.
- Coordinates assigned processes (e.g. screening, enrollment, payroll, testing, etc.) for the purpose of ensuring accurate completion of scheduled District activities and processes.
- Maintains manual and electronic documents files and records (e.g. letters, forms, reports, etc.) for the purpose of providing up-to-date information and historical reference in accordance with established administrative guidelines and legal requirements.
- Monitors inventory of supplies and materials (e.g. forms, office supplies, etc.) for the purpose of ensuring inventory availability.
- Oversees data (e.g. varied data collection for site, as required, etc.) for the purpose of ensuring accuracy for data application.
- Prepares standardized documents and reports (e.g. form letters and memos, calendars, bulletins, periodic reports, etc.) for the purpose of ensuring proper conveyance.
- Processes documents and materials (e.g. work orders, expense claims, department, District, State reports., etc.) for the purpose of providing required information, in accordance to District and State requirements.
- Researches rules, laws, programs (e.g. curriculum changes, employee hiring, class schedules, testing, etc.) for the purpose of ensuring necessary changes for future efficiency; attaining District goals for learning and employment fairness.
- Performs other related duties as assigned for the purpose of ensuring the efficient and effective functioning of the work unit.
- Age 16+
- High school diploma or equivalent.
